All Jammu Cottage Industry Union formed

Excelsior Correspondent
JAMMU, Aug 21: Weavers and artisans here today held a meeting to discuss the burning issues confronting handloom and handicraft workers of Jammu province.
It was decided in the meeting to form a Union to bring the artisans on one platform and to bring the issues they are facing before the authorities concerned.
The meeting was presided over by Vinod Koul, ex-GM JKHDC and was chaired by BJP leader, Chander Mohan Sharma.
It was decided in the meeting to form a Union with name All Jammu Cottage Industry Union to address the issues of artisans of cottage industry and Chander Mohan Sharma was elected as chairman/patron.
The executive presidents elected were Shuban Kumar (Handicrafts) and Vinod Koul (Handlooms); Sureshta Khanmotra was made secretary (Handicrafts); Rajesh Sharma, secretary; Sushma Rani, secretary (Handloom) and Aminder Kour, treasurer (Handloom).
Vote of thanks was given by Vinod Koul.
